Key ceremony checklist — item 7 (Tilefetch prefetcher)

Before we rotate the signing keys for Tilefetch, make sure the prefetcher is drained — otherwise it'll keep requesting tiles signed with the old key and spam the error dashboard for an hour. Pause the prefetch queue, confirm zero in-flight fetches, then proceed with rotation. Once the new keys are sealed, re-enable prefetch and watch cache hit rates for ten minutes. The sealed key bundle opens with the recovery passphrase below.

vault phrase of bagaf-kajeg = jorath-feniel-briir-siliel-ralix

Subject: Date localization pass ready for review

Hey release folks,

The locale-aware date formatting for Pinwheel Notes is finally in. We swapped the hardcoded MM/DD strings for the Lintquist formatter, so users in the Varsholm region stop seeing ambiguous dates in the activity feed. Tests cover 14 locales, plus a fallback when the locale pack is missing. Would love a reviewer to sanity-check the pluralization edge cases. The candidate build token is pasted right below for convenience.

session token of tajef-bageg = htk21_5d90d574934f3ccae6437

**Ticket: Config drift on BounceSift processor**

The email bounce processor in the Larkfield environment has drifted from the values committed in the release branch. Retry windows and suppression thresholds no longer match, which likely explains the duplicate suppression entries reported Tuesday. Please reconcile before the Thursday cut. For reference, the currently deployed configuration on the live node reads as follows.

config for yajep-yahof:
[briax]
port = 9200
region = outer-2
host = briax.nelvrocorp.test
team = raleth
timeout_ms = 1500
retries = 1